Project Manager – Renewables (California) Remote/Hybrid

Tetra Tech is a leader in water, environment, and sustainable infrastructure, seeking a Project Manager - Renewables to join their California Energy Practice. This role involves managing renewable energy projects, building client relationships, and leading teams to deliver technical and regulatory solutions.

Responsibilities

Serve as Project Manager, leading technical projects, budgets, and client communications
Identify new business opportunities, prepare proposals and cost estimates, and develop project approaches
Manage and oversee preparation of land-use and resource permit applications for federal, state, and local agencies
Support and lead siting, permitting, and environmental review for renewable energy projects
Oversee project execution to ensure quality, schedule, and budget compliance
Participate in and support business development initiatives, including proposal preparation and client meetings
Coordinate project schedules, budgets, deliverables, and staff assignments
Ensure compliance with Tetra Tech’s health, safety, and quality standards
Perform other related duties as assigned

Required

Bachelor's degree in Environmental Science, Environmental Engineering, Biology, Geology, or a related field
7–15 years of experience managing and supporting CEQA projects, including preparation of IS/MNDs, EIRs, or related CEQA documentation
Proven experience with California permitting processes, including agencies such as: California Energy Commission (CEC), California Public Utilities Commission (CPUC), California Coastal Commission (CCC), California Department of Fish and Wildlife (CDFW), Regional Water Quality Control Boards, Local land-use agencies
Prior environmental consulting experience strongly preferred
Familiarity with the NEPA process a plus
Excellent organizational, communication, and writing skills
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ook)
Strong ability to manage multiple priorities and work independently in a fast-paced environment
Must possess a valid driver's license with a clean driving record without restrictions

Preferred

Master's degree in a related discipline
Experience managing complex, multi-disciplinary projects in California
Experience with energy development clients and large-scale renewable projects
